Strengths & Weaknesses

Intel Core i3-1220P

Pros

  • Excellent multi-tasking capability thanks to 8 E-cores
  • Low 28 W power draw enables good battery life in thin laptops
  • Iris Xe 64EU graphics are significantly better than desktop i3 iGPU
  • 10 cores provide strong multi-threaded specs for the price tier
  • Handles everyday web and office tasks with ease

Cons

  • Only 2 P-cores severely limit single-threaded and active workload performance
  • E-cores cannot match P-core performance in demanding applications
  • 28 W base power limits sustained performance in thermally constrained chassis
  • Not suitable for serious content creation or heavy productivity
  • E-core heavy design can cause inconsistent performance in poorly threaded applications
Intel Core i3-1315UE

Pros

  • Hybrid architecture brings better multi-threading to entry-level mobile
  • Very low 15W base power for thin chassis designs
  • Supports modern LPDDR5-6400 memory
  • PCIe 4.0 support for faster NVMe storage
  • Capable UHD Graphics 64EU for a 15W chip

Cons

  • Very low 1.2 GHz base clock leads to sluggishness at sustained loads
  • Only 8 PCIe lanes directly from the CPU
  • No overclocking support
  • Not suitable for gaming or content creation
  • BGA package means no upgrade path

Our Verdict on Each

The i3-1220P maximizes core count on a budget by using 8 E-cores, delivering excellent multitasking for thin-and-light laptops but falling short in single-threaded tasks compared to processors with more P-cores.

Best for: The i3-1220P is not a standalone purchase but a component integrated into laptops. When shopping for a thin-and-light laptop in 2022-2023, a machine with the 1220P offers a good balance of everyday performance and battery life for web browsing, office work, and media consumption. However, be aware that the 2 P-cores will limit performance in CPU-intensive applications like video editing or heavy compiling. If your laptop budget allows, stepping up to an i5-1240P or i5-12500P provides 4 P-cores and significantly better sustained performance for a modest price increase.
